Copacabana
Copacabana is a town and municipality in the Colombian department of Antioquia. Founded in 1615, Copacabana is part of the Metropolitan Area of the Aburrá Valley.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Girardota
Town
Photo: XalD,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Girardota is a town and municipality in Antioquia Department, Colombia. Girardota is part of The Metropolitan Area of the Aburrá Valley. Its population was estimated to be 54,439 in 2020. Girardota is situated 8 km northeast of Copacabana.
